FL S0150
Bill
AI Summary
-
Requires each Florida school district to adopt a tobacco-free policy prohibiting the use or distribution of tobacco products in all school facilities, on school grounds, in school vehicles, and at all school functions
-
Policy must apply to faculty, administrators, staff, school bus drivers, organizations using school property, and anyone supervising students during school-sponsored activities
-
School districts must establish procedures to communicate the tobacco-free policy to staff, students, families, visitors, and the public, and must refer individuals to voluntary cessation education programs
-
Prohibits using school district facilities, property, or vehicles for tobacco product advertising
-
Expands the existing ban on smoking within 1,000 feet of schools to apply to all persons, not just those under 18, and removes the previous 6 a.m. to midnight time restriction
